🍽️ Quiche with Green Beans and Bayonne Ham
532 kcal · 30 min · 4 servings

Ingredients
- butter 125 g
- wheat flour, Type 405 250 g
- eggs 6 pcs
- salt pinch
- water 5 tbsp
- green beans 600 g
- onions, yellow 1 pcs
- oil 1 tbsp
- garlic cloves 1 pcs
- thyme, fresh 5 g
- crème fraîche 200 g
- pepper, black ground pinch
- ham from Bayonne 200 g
Instructions
- 1. Preheat the oven to 220 degrees Celsius using top and bottom heat.
- 2. Cut the cold butter into small cubes.
- 3. Place the butter cubes, flour, one egg, salt, and water into a bowl.
- 4. Knead the ingredients together by hand until you have a smooth dough.
- 5. Dust a work surface with flour and roll out the dough to a thickness of about two millimeters.
- 6. Grease a square quiche dish (approx. 32 x 12 cm).
- 7. Place the dough in the dish and form a border about three centimeters high.
- 8. Press the dough firmly against the bottom and sides of the dish.
- 9. Trim the excess dough at the edge straight with a knife.
- 10. Prick the bottom of the dough several times with a fork.
- 11. Bring about two liters of salted water to a boil in a pot.
- 12. Wash the green beans and trim off the ends.
- 13. Add the beans to the boiling salted water for about five minutes.
- 14. Drain the beans in a colander.
- 15. Rinse the beans briefly with cold water to cool them down.
- 16. Halve the onion and peel it.
- 17. Finely dice the onion.
- 18. Peel the garlic and chop it finely.
- 19. Heat oil in a pan over medium heat.
- 20. Sauté the onions and garlic for about two minutes.
- 21. Distribute the green beans evenly over the quiche base.
- 22. Distribute the sautéed onions evenly over the quiche.
- 23. Wash the thyme and shake it dry.
- 24. Strip the thyme leaves from the stems.
- 25. Finely chop the thyme leaves.
- 26. Combine the thyme, crème fraîche, and the remaining eggs in a bowl.
- 27. Season the egg mixture with salt and pepper.
- 28. Pour the egg mixture over the vegetables in the quiche.
- 29. Bake the quiche in the oven for about 30 to 35 minutes.
- 30. Place the quiche on the bottom rack while baking.
- 31. Let the quiche cool down for a short while.
- 32. Roll the Bayonne ham into small rosettes.
- 33. Garnish the quiche with the ham rosettes.
- 34. Serve the quiche and enjoy your meal!
Nutrition per serving
- kcal: 532
- Protein: 26 g · Fett/Fat: 36 g · Carbs: 30 g
